Asphalt Crack Sealing in Grand Rapids, MI
Asphalt crack sealing is a maintenance process that involves filling and sealing cracks in asphalt surfaces to prevent water infiltration and further deterioration. This service is commonly requested for driveways, parking lots, and private roads to extend the lifespan of the asphalt and maintain a smooth, safe surface. Property owners typically want to understand the types of cracks that can be treated, the benefits of sealing, and how this preventative measure can help avoid more costly repairs in the future.
Before requesting asphalt crack sealing, homeowners should consider the extent and severity of the cracks on their surfaces. Cracks that are narrow and less than a quarter-inch wide are usually suitable for sealing, while larger or more extensive cracking may require additional repair solutions. It is also helpful to know that sealing is most effective when performed before cracks widen or cause underlying damage, making early intervention an important factor in maintaining asphalt integrity.

Asphalt Crack Sealing Questions
What is asphalt crack sealing? It is a process that involves filling and sealing cracks in asphalt surfaces to prevent water infiltration and further damage.
Why is crack sealing important? Sealing cracks helps extend the lifespan of asphalt surfaces by preventing deterioration caused by moisture and debris.
What types of cracks are suitable for sealing? Common cracks such as longitudinal, transverse, and alligator cracks can typically be sealed to improve pavement durability.
When should crack sealing be performed? Crack sealing is best done when cracks are active and before larger potholes or extensive damage develop.
